-1. A car starts at 2.5 m/s and accelerates to 10.2 m/s. What is the average speed of the car
during the time it accelerates? - -6.4 m/s
-Which of the following statements is consistent with Newton's laws of motion? - -An object in
motion will remain in motion until an external force changes its motion.
-A rock is dropped into a well and hits the water in 2.7 s. How deep is the well? Use the
expression, d = ½gt2, where g is the gravitational constant (9.81 m/s2). - -36 m
-A ball is thrown at an angle of 45°. What is the shape of its trajectory while it is in the air? - -
Parabolic
-Force is given by the expression, F = ma. What are the units of force in metric units? - -kg m/s2
-A 10.6-g piece of silly putty moving at 3.75 m/s in a particular direction collides with a 12.5-g
stationary piece of silly putty. The two pieces of silly putty stick and continue in the same
direction. Ignoring friction, what is the speed of the two pieces moving together. - -1.72 m/s
, -A force of 4.5 N is applied to an object for 2.5 s. What is the impulse? - -11 kg•m/s
-An object moving in circular motion accelerates: - -Toward the center of the circular motion
-Which of the following statements is consistent with the law of universal gravitation? - -The
force of attraction between two objects in the universe is inversely proportional to the square
of their distances, Every object in the universe is attracted to all other objects in the universe,
The force exerted by an object in the universe is directly proportional to its mass.
-An object in circular motion is moving at a speed of 4.75 m/s. If the radius of the circular
motion is reduced to half, what is the new speed if the centripetal acceleration stays the same?
- -3.36 m/s
